Markus Kludzuweit
Markus Kludzuweit is a prominent German composer known for his contributions to video game music. He gained significant recognition for his work on the strategy game "Anno 1701," which was released in 2006. The game's soundtrack, characterized by its rich orchestration and immersive themes, enhanced the player's experience and helped establish Kludzuweit as a notable figure in the industry. His compositions often blend classical elements with modern techniques, creating a unique auditory landscape that complements gameplay. Kludzuweit's work extends beyond "Anno 1701," contributing to various other titles, further solidifying his reputation as a talented composer in the realm of interactive entertainment. His ability to evoke emotion and atmosphere through music continues to resonate with gamers and composers alike.
